同花顺数据库连接python
时间: 2024-08-12 16:03:54 浏览: 104
同花顺数据接口主要是供开发者使用的,它允许Python等编程语言通过API访问其股票、期货等金融数据。要连接同花顺数据库到Python,通常需要以下几个步骤:
1. 安装所需库:首先,你需要安装`yf`(Yahoo Finance)库,这是一个广泛用于获取金融数据的库,它提供了对同花顺数据的支持。
```bash
pip install yf
```
2. 导入库并导入数据:使用`yf.download()`函数下载数据,例如获取股票数据:
```python
import yfinance as yf
stock_data = yf.download('AAPL', start='2020-01-01', end='2022-12-31')
```
这里,`'AAPL'`代表苹果公司的股票代码,`start`和`end`则是你要获取的历史日期范围。
3. 数据处理:下载的数据通常是以pandas DataFrame的形式,你可以像操作其他DataFrame一样对其进行清洗、分析。
相关问题
python 抓取同花顺概念股票
要使用Python抓取同花顺概念股票数据,可以使用以下步骤:
第一步,导入所需的库。使用Python的requests库向同花顺的概念股票接口发送HTTP请求,并使用BeautifulSoup库对获取到的HTML进行解析。
第二步,发送HTTP请求。构建合适的URL,发送GET请求,并获取到返回的HTML页面。
第三步,解析HTML页面。使用BeautifulSoup解析HTML页面,并提取出需要的数据。可以使用BeautifulSoup的find和find_all方法根据HTML的标签和属性来定位到需要的数据。
第四步,数据处理和保存。对提取到的数据进行必要的处理,比如清洗、格式化等,然后保存到合适的数据结构中,比如字典、列表等,便于后续的数据分析和使用。
第五步,循环处理多页数据。如果需要抓取多页数据,可以通过修改URL中的页数参数,循环发送HTTP请求,然后将每页获取到的数据合并到同一个数据结构中。
第六步,异常处理。在整个抓取过程中,可能会遇到网络连接问题、页面解析错误等异常情况,需要适当的进行异常处理,防止程序中断。
第七步,结果展示。根据需要,可以将抓取到的数据进行展示,比如打印到终端、保存到文件、存入数据库等。
最后,可以将以上步骤封装成一个函数或类,便于调用和复用。注意,向同花顺的接口发送请求时,需要按照其网站的使用协议进行,遵守相关规定,以免引起不必要的问题。
阅读全文